There are some things i'd like to mention here :
- The game does lack the minimum amount of contrast, it's more on the greyish side, nothing really bad, as i'm using Reshade 6.7.3 to compensate, with Fake HDR and Curves to add the missing contrast and boost the tones, with this, the interiors are gorgeous and the overall graphis looks pretty nice (don't know if someone can confirm that, but someone said that you could get banned if going multiplayer with the shaders on, that's why i'm staying solo, i'm doing the same in AMS2 with only the fake HDR and keep going multiplayer).
I wish the devs could work on that, because with some better shaders, better contrast, nothing crazy, this game can look really awesome.
- One feature i'd like to see, but it's more of an habit, is the possibility to keep driving a bit at the end of a race, as it does stop really quick, something like pressing a button, the same way you're having it in LMU/ACC. Could be interesting.
- The last one, and i know some people won't agree, is to lower the exagerated sliding/spinning of the cars, when being bumped by another AI, driving two centimeters on the grass, or just losing the control of the car on a straight line at medium speed as it happend on some occasions on the Sebring with a GT3 and an hypercar. I understand the idea of not pushing your car too far and keeping the control of it, but most of the time it's not the case, i do accept this when i made a mistake (happened in LMU, AAC, AMS2 and i was responsible for it, but that's not the case here, it looks more like artificial difficulty to present the game as a sim racing than a real reaction due to a mistake).
- I'd like to mention here some better looking skies (EVO and AAC are a good exemple to me), with more density, as it's a good thing in my opinion to make the screen space as a whole (the road, the cars/interiors/exteriors), it would totally be a great addition, nothing crazy, but something to give more dynamic to the game.
